Wastewater treatment is typically divided into stages such as pretreatment, primary treatment, and secondary treatment. The addition of
flocculants is primarily concentrated in the primary treatment stage, with some processes also incorporating auxiliary
flocculant dosing during pretreatment or advanced treatment. Specific applications are as follows: 1. Primary treatment stage (core dosing point) Scenario: After entering the primary sedimentation tank, sewage is treated by adding
flocculants (such as polyaluminium chloride and polyacrylamide). These
flocculants, through their charge neutralization and adsorption bridging effects, cause suspended particles and colloidal impurities to aggregate into large flocs. Function: Accelerate solid sedimentation, significantly reduce wastewater turbidity, SS (suspended solids), and part of COD (chemical oxygen demand), thereby reducing the load on subsequent biochemical treatment.

2. Preprocessing stage (auxiliary input point) Scenario: If the concentration of suspended solids in the raw water is extremely high (such as industrial wastewater), a small amount of
flocculant can be added in advance after screening and regulation in the pool to initially coagulate large particles of impurities. Function: Prevent subsequent pipeline blockages and enhance primary treatment efficiency. 3. Advanced Treatment Stage (Specific Process Addition Point) Scenario: Before processes such as membrane treatment and advanced oxidation, if the turbidity of the effluent does not meet the standard,
flocculant can be added for secondary flocculation. Function: To ensure the operational stability of precision processing equipment (such as membrane modules) and prevent contaminants from blocking the membrane pores. Key points of dosing: Water quality adaptation: Select chemicals based on the pH value and type of pollutants in the wastewater (e.g., iron salts for alkaline wastewater, aluminum salts for acidic wastewater). Concentration control: Determine the optimal dosage through beaker experiments to avoid excessive dosage leading to viscous water or increased costs. Process synergy: Flocculation is often combined with coagulation and sedimentation processes to form an integrated “coagulation-flocculation-sedimentation” workflow, enhancing treatment efficiency. The scientific dosing of
flocculants is a crucial step in solid-liquid separation in wastewater treatment. The dosing point needs to be flexibly adjusted based on water quality characteristics and process objectives, in order to achieve a balance between efficient purification and cost optimization.
